Are you an enthusiastic ColdFusion developer looking to work for a leading edge company? Then you could work for an innovative ColdFusion development company in Brighton!
TalkWebSolutions are looking for a keen, self motivated web developer who has an eye for detail. The role will entail developing dynamic, intuitive websites and online business applications for a wide range of clients and products.
The core skills TWS are looking for are:
* ColdFusion 7+
* MS SQL
* CF Frameworks (knowledge of either of the following: fusebox, coldspring, transfer, coldbox, model-glue)
Some bonus points would come if you have these skills:
* Ajax (jQuery, Spry, Ext etc)
* Unit testing
* UI testing
* Project management
If you're a person who is:
* Looking to work on the latest technologies and push the web to it's limits
* A good communicator with good writing skills
* Looking to enhance their technical ability
* Good at soling problems
* Looking for a flexible working environment
This position is based in Brighton, East Sussex.

We're very big fans of CFML / ColdFusion and a way in which we show this is via sponsoring events. We've recently sponsored cf.Objective().
cf.Objective() is the first conference to concentrate entirely on the most advanced and cutting-edge techniques in the ColdFusion world.- The top speakers in the ColdFusion community -- Sean Corfield, Jason Delmore, Mark Drew, Chris Scott, Mark Mandel, Joe Rinehart and many more.
- In-depth, solid presentations on more advanced topics -- perfect for your intermediate and senior developers!
- An intimate atmosphere -- small enough to give your developers access to those experienced speakers and attendees, so that they will learn even while they network!

If you, like me, have found it rather hard to find a conclusive website where you can find art events occurring in and around your location then our new bespoke web site development project is for you.
ArtCalendr.com (http://www.artcalendr.com) not only allows you to easily find events but it also allows you to 'organise your art life' through its calendr system and to-do lists.
ArtCalendr is a free online service that provides comprehensive details on art exhibitions and events taking place at more than 20,000 venues in over 40 countries.
Another great feature of the site is the artFindr area.
